What Happened?

The crash wasn’t political; it was a pure tech fail inside Binance.

An analysis report lays it bare: That epic meltdown on Oct 10-11? Forget Trump tariffs or China trade jabs; it was a glitch in Binance’s margin collateral calc that turned everything upside down. What felt like the biggest crypto scam in history unfolded right there.

From Oct 6-14; Binance switched collateral pricing to internal quotes instead of market averages; crashing USDe to $0.65 on their platform while it stuck at $1 outside. Boom; massive liquidations; billions gone in seconds.

Liquidity vanished fast; surprise dumps of 60-90M USDe triggered auto-liquidations on BTC and ETH; wiping over $19B market-wide. I to break down to you The Largest Crypto Scam in Human History.

The kicker? Wintermute yanked their liquidity an hour before; while pre-set shorts on Hyperliquid cashed $192M profits.

Binance admitted the mess and promised $283M in user comps; but trust shattered.

This wasn’t media-hyped “global shock”; it was an internal glitch shaking the top exchange; proving the market’s still fragile; size be damned.
